W miarę dojrzewania rynku kryptowalut, prywatność cyfrowa stała się kluczowym zagadnieniem, gdyż ataki phishingowe i inne zaawansowane incydenty związane z cyberbezpieczeństwem zyskują na intensywności. W cieniu tego nowa technologia blockchain nazwana Dowodami o Zerowej Wiedzy (ZKP) staje się obrońcą prywatności. ZKP wyłonił się jako superbohater kryptograficzny w świecie blockchain w momencie, gdy szkody spowodowane cyberprzestępczością mają osiągnąć 10,5 biliona dolarów w 2025 roku.
Gdy sieci blockchain przetwarzają miliony transakcji dziennie, ZKP oferują eleganckie rozwiązanie odwiecznego dylematu: jak zachować transparentność przy jednoczesnym ochronie poufności.
Rozłożenie na Części: Co To Dokładnie Jest Dowód o Zerowej Wiedzy?
W swojej istocie Dowód o Zerowej Wiedzy to jak posiadanie doskonałej pokerowej twarzy, próbując udowodnić, że masz królewskiego pokera - nigdy nie pokazując swoich kart. Ta kryptograficzna metoda, po raz pierwszy sformułowana w przełomowym artykule MIT z 1985 roku przez Shafi'ego Goldwassera i Silvio Micali, przeszła ewolucję od akademickiej koncepcji do fundamentu nowoczesnej prywatności blockchain.
Matematyczne piękno ZKP tkwi w ich trzech fundamentalnych właściwościach:
- Kompletnosć: Jeśli mówisz prawdę, zawsze możesz to udowodnić
- Solidność: Jeśli kłamiesz, zostaniesz przyłapany (z ogromnym prawdopodobieństwem)
- Zerowa wiedza: Weryfikator nie dowiaduje się niczego oprócz tego, czy mówisz prawdę
Pod Maską: Mechanika Za Tajemnicą
Pomyśl o Dowodach o Zerowej Wiedzy jak o zaawansowanej grze "20 pytań", w której odpowiadający (dający dowód) przekonuje pytającego (weryfikatora), że wie coś, nie ujawniając dokładnie, co to jest. Proces obejmuje:
- Generowanie Zdania: Dawca dowodu formułuje matematyczne zdanie reprezentujące wiedzę, którą chce udowodnić
- Protokół Odpowiadań Na Wyzwania: Weryfikator wydaje losowe wyzwania
- Weryfikacja: Dawca dowodu odpowiada rozwiązaniami, które tylko ktoś z prawdziwą wiedzą mógłby podać
- Analiza Prawdopodobieństwa: Po wielu rundach weryfikator jest przekonany z matematyczną pewnością
Na przykład, w transakcji blockchain używającej ZKP:
- Ważność transakcji jest weryfikowana bez ujawniania kwot
- Tożsamość nadawcy jest uwierzytelniana bez ujawniania adresów
- Warunki inteligentnych kontraktów są sprawdzane bez ujawniania danych wejściowych
Drzewo Rodzinne ZKP: Głębokie Wejście w Typy i Implementacje
zk-SNARKs: Lekki Mistrz
Architektura Techniczna:
- Używa par do krzywych eliptycznych do weryfikacji
- Wymaga ceremonii zaufanego ustawienia
- Rozmiar dowodu: Około 288 bajtów
- Czas weryfikacji: ~10 milisekund
Kluczowe Cechy:
- Dowody o stałym rozmiarze bez względu na złożoność obliczeniową
- Weryfikacja nieinteraktywna
- Bardzo wydajny gazowo na Ethereum
Znaczące Implementacje:
- Zcash: Przetwarza ponad 20 000 ukrytych transakcji miesięcznie
- Loopring: Przetwarza codziennie 100 000+ transakcji
- Mina Protocol: Utrzymuje rozmiar blockchaina na poziomie 22kb
zk-STARKs: Moc przeznaczona do przyszłego działania wobec komputerów kwantowych
Specyfikacje Techniczne:
- Używa funkcji haszujących zamiast krzywych eliptycznych
- Nie wymaga zaufanego ustawienia
- Rozmiar dowodu: 45-200kb (w zależności od obliczeń)
- Czas weryfikacji: 50-200 milisekund
Wyjątkowe Zalety:
- Kryptografia odporna na komputery kwantowe
- Przezroczysty proces ustawienia
- Szybsze generowanie dowodów (do 10x niższe w porównaniu z SNARKs)
Zastosowania W Praktyce:
- StarkNet: Przetwarza codziennie 500 000+ transakcji
- Cairo: Wspiera złożone dowody obliczeniowe
- dYdX: Przetwarza wolumen handlowy analiony 2 miliardów USD dziennie
PLONK: Specjalista Od Uniwersalnej Konfiguracji
Innowacje Techniczne:
- Uniwersalna zaufana konfiguracja
- Zaangażowania wielomianowe
- Niestandardowe projekty bramek
Zaawansowane Funkcje:
- Obsługuje dowolny obwód arytmetyczny
- Modułowa kompozycja dowodów
- Zdolności do dowodów rekurencyjnych
Przykłady Implementacji:
- Polygon Zero: Osiąga 10 000 TPS
- Aztec Protocol: Prywatne transakcje DeFi
- Matter Labs: Rozwiązania skalujące warstwy 2
Bulletproofs: Ekspert Od Dowodów Zakresów
Szczegóły Techniczne:
- Brak zaufanego ustawienia
- Liniowe skalowanie dzięki rozmiarowi wejściowemu
- Efektywne dowody zakresu
Kluczowe Zalety:
- Optymalne dla małych dowodów
- Prosta implementacja
- Idealne dla utajnionych transakcji
Zastosowania w Praktyce:
- Monero: Kryptowaluta skoncentrowana na prywatności
- Assety Poufne: Prywatność tokenów
- MimbleWimble: Protokół blockchain
Od Teorii do Praktyki: Rzeczywiste Zastosowania ZKP
Prywatność Pierwsza w DeFi: Nowa Granica Finansowa
Adaptacja protokołów DeFi obsługujących ZKP gwałtownie wzrosła, z:
- Ponad 15 miliardów USD w przetworzonych transakcjach prywatnych
- Wzrost o 500% w liczbie aktywnych użytkowników dziennie
- Ponad 30 dużych protokołów wdrażających technologię ZKP
Rozwiązania Skalowania: Przełamywanie Trylematu Blockchain
ZK-rollupy stały się złotym standardem skalowania:
- Przetwarzanie ponad 2 milionów transakcji codziennie
- Redukcja opłat gazowych do 99%
- Zachowanie gwarancji bezpieczeństwa poziomu Ethereum
Tożsamość Cyfrowa 2.0: Prywatność Zachowana w Weryfikacji
Rozwiązania tożsamości oparte na ZKP rewolucjonizują uwierzytelnianie:
- Ponad 10 milionów zweryfikowanych cyfrowych tożsamości
- Obniżenie liczby kradzieży tożsamości o 70%
- Integracja z ponad 100 głównymi dostawcami usług
Przyjęcie przez Firmy: Przełom W Przestrzeni Prywatności Korporacyjnej
Duże korporacje przyjmują technologię ZKP:
- Przewidywana wielkość rynku na poziomie 3,5 miliarda USD do 2026 roku
- 45% roczny wzrost przyjęcia w przedsiębiorstwach
- Implementacja w łańcuchu dostaw, sektorze zdrowia i finansowym
Przyszłość Dowodów o Zerowej Wiedzy wykracza poza obecne zastosowania. W obliczu nadchodzącej ery komputerów kwantowych i nasilających się obaw o prywatność ZKP stoją w pozycji, by stać się fundamentem poufnego przetwarzania danych w erze Web3. Dzięki trwającym badaniom nad systemami dowodów i optymalizacją implementacji, zaledwie dotykamy możliwych rozwiązań, jakie niesie ta transformacyjna technologia.